Building - Deployment of RWAs
Jia is a decentralized lending protocol focused on deploying RWAs on Arbitrum. The project is already operational and has a clear go-to-market plan.
Funding Request ($USD)
The funding request of $40,000 is within the program's scope and appears reasonable given the scale and impact of the project.
What problem is your project solving in the RWA space?
Jia addresses a significant financing gap for MSMEs in emerging markets, utilizing decentralized capital and AI-powered risk assessment tools to solve key issues.
Explain how your project is different from others and will bring value to the RWA ecosystem on Arbitrum.
The project uniquely balances financial returns with social impact, leveraging Arbitrum’s capabilities to enhance scalability and security while providing a blueprint for mission-focused projects.
What stage of development is your project currently in?
Jia has been operational for two years, with a proven track record in Kenya and the Philippines. They are in the planning phase for implementing invoice tokenization, with a detailed roadmap for execution.
What is the target audience for this project?
The target audience includes crypto-native investors seeking sustainable yields and portfolio diversification into emerging markets. The project is designed to attract more capital for borrowers in these regions.
What are the roles and experiences of project team members?
The team is highly experienced, with backgrounds in financial services, credit products, and emerging markets. Notable members include Zach Marks, Cheng Cheng, Michael Dettmar, Mark Mwaniki, and Krizanne Ty.
How much funding has your project raised already?
Jia has raised $6.6M in capital, including $5.5M through equity and $1.1M through debt, showcasing strong financial backing.
Is this project already funded by other grant programs? If funded by any Arbitrum-related programs, please specify.
The project has not been funded by other grant programs, ensuring it is not receiving duplicate funding from Arbitrum-related sources.
Is the project aiming to deploy on Arbitrum in the short-to-medium term?
Jia aims to deploy on Arbitrum and utilize its Layer 2 rollup chain in the short-to-medium term, aligning with the program's goals.
Will the project attract larger projects and speed up the growth of the Arbitrum ecosystem?
With its focus on real-world impact and strong financial returns, Jia is positioned to attract investors and larger projects, fostering ecosystem growth.
